PMDG – 777-300ER MSFS First Update Available

PMDG has released the first update for their 777-300ER for Microsoft Flight Simulator, addressing various issues identified since its initial launch. This update, version 2.00.0034, was distributed via the Operations Center Micro-Update system, allowing for quick fixes. The update includes corrections for freezing issues related to the CLR button, improvements to the FMS functionality, refinements to virtual cockpit textures, and adjustments to external model geometry. These initial fixes aim to enhance the user experience and address disruptive problems promptly.

The team is particularly focused on a significant issue caused by SU15, which affects cockpit responsiveness. Despite extensive testing, this problem has proven difficult to resolve due to its sporadic occurrence. PMDG is collaborating with Asobo, the developers of MSFS, to identify and fix the root cause of this issue. They encourage users experiencing this problem to contact their tech support for further investigation. Additional updates are planned over the next two weeks, targeting various user-reported issues and continuing efforts to stabilize the product.

PMDG is committed to ongoing improvements and user satisfaction, with dedicated teams working on both functional and aesthetic aspects of the 777-300ER. They advise users to report issues through proper channels to ensure they are logged and addressed efficiently. As they continue to monitor the product’s performance, they appreciate the community’s patience and support, and they look forward to seeing users enjoy the 777-300ER in their virtual flights.

Changelog 2.00.0034
Released 2024-06-28

14289: [FREEZES – All Types] Protection against CLR (fmc message) button causing a sim lockup (emvaos)
14320: [FMS – Route/Legs Pages] ACTIVATE+EXECUTE a RTE with no waypoints (emvaos)
14272: [FMS – SID/STAR pages] Handling omni bearing non-runway specific SIDs (eg. KIAD CLUTCH3) (emvaos)
14340: [Virtual Cockpit – Geometry/Textures] Gap on glareshield when looked from outside (jbrown)
14288: [Virtual Cockpit – Geometry/Textures] MCP buttons need refinements (vscimone)
14266: [External Model – Geometry] Cabin Curtains disappear under certain conditions (hvanrensburg)
14294: [Virtual Cockpit – Functionality/Click-Spots] Lights Intensity (abashkatov)
14296: [ACARS – Datalink/Connectivity] Cancel on EICAS causes freeze (hvanrensburg)
14241: [External Model – Geometry] GSX Profile – Issues (jbrown)
14246: [ACARS – CPDLC] Hoppie Login no longer working with Vatsim (hvanrensburg)
14076: [Virtual Cockpit – Geometry/Textures] 5R door ARM handle remains in DISARMED position (hvanrensburg)
14279: [External Model – Geometry] Brake Wear Indicator Pins in wrong place? (jbrown)
14297: [External Model – Geometry] Engine blade spacing on one blade is slightly off? (jbrown)
14322: [ACARS – Datalink/Connectivity] Can’t send requests on COMM (hvanrensburg)
0000: [Wheels & Brakes] – Parking brake cannot be released in Simple Mode.
